About the Item

Beautiful Baroque drink glass 'Rummer' (Römer or Roemer) among other drinking glass studded with prunts to ensure a safe grip. Popular in the Rhineland and the Netherlands during the 17th and 18th century. The glass is very rare and a really collectors item, The glass is hand blown and in a perfect condition. Artefact: Rummer. (A) Country: Netherlands. Culture: Dutch Date: 18th century.. Medium: Greenish transparent free blown glass.. Lit: “Glass in the Rijksmuseum”, Amsterdam, 1993. Vol. I, page 145, no. 207.
